    Joy Roman

    Executive Head of HR at De Beers Group

    Professional Background

    Joy Roman is a highly accomplished human resources professional with an extensive background in strategy, marketing, and organizational development. As the Executive Head of HR at De Beers Group, Joy has effectively driven talent management initiatives that align organizational goals with workforce development strategies. Her expertise in HR operations spans several prestigious organizations, showcasing her capability to lead human resource functions across diverse regions and industries.

    Prior to joining De Beers Group, Joy served as the Chief Human Resources Officer (CHRO) and Senior Vice President of HR at Toll Brothers, where she played a vital role in enhancing employee engagement and optimizing HR processes. Joy’s impressive career at 3M is marked by progressive leadership positions, including her roles as Equity and Executive Compensation Manager, as well as Head of Talent Development, in which she helped to shape the future talent strategies for the Asia division. Her commitment to nurturing talent saw her managing HR operations not only in Singapore, but across Southeast Asia, contributing to a culture of high performance and innovation.

    Joy’s career trajectory began as an Associate Management Consultant at McKinsey & Company, where she honed her analytical and strategic thinking skills.     Education and Achievements

    Joy Roman possesses a strong educational foundation that underpins her expertise in human resources and strategic management. She earned her MBA in Strategy and Marketing from Yale University, specifically from the Yale School of Management.     Joy's undergraduate studies include a Bachelor of Arts in English and Communications from the University of Wisconsin-Madison, where she developed vital communication skills that have proven essential in her professional endeavors.
